The Journey to Eurosong 2025 continues! This year, six incredible artists will compete for the chance to represent Ireland at the Eurovision Song Contest 2025. In this exciting mini-series, Conor, Lou, and Alex will dive deep into the songs vying for your vote and chat with the stars themselves ahead of the live show on The Late Late Show on February 7th. In today's episode, we're joined by Reylta! A singer-songwriter from rural Ireland, Reylta weaves bittersweet melodies with an alternative edge, creating music deeply rooted in Irish heritage. Inspired by Ireland's poetic traditions, evocative landscapes, and rich storytelling, her sound combines poetic lyrics, lush string arrangements, and haunting harmonies for a uniquely transcendent experience.


Since 2017, Reylta has performed with her band, gaining attention with her debut single Fools Games in 2019. Her first album, Everything Unsaved Will Be Lost, released last October, earned critical acclaim, with the Irish Independent crowning her "Galway’s Alt Folk Queen."


She'll be singing her song, 'Fire' on Eurosong 2025.
